"Goodfellas" has unfortunately lost another cast member.

Chuck Low, who played Morris "Morire" Kesseler in Martin Scorsese's classic mobster film, passed away on Sept. 18, reports confirmed on Tuesday. He was 89.

Low's death came just one week after the passing of Frank Vincent, who also starred in the film.

A close friend of "Goodfellas" leading man Robert De Niro, Low was De Niro's landlord when the now-major movie star first got into acting.

Much like several other "Goodfellas" actors, Low would later land a role in HBO's "The Sopranos." But perhaps more importantly, he was an esteemed military veteran who served 30 years as a reserve and four on active duty.
